Saeed Safari is a scholar working on Surgery, Emergency Medicine and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Saeed Safari has authored 155 papers receiving a total of 2.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 45 papers in Surgery, 41 papers in Emergency Medicine and 24 papers in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. Recurrent topics in Saeed Safari's work include Emergency and Acute Care Studies (20 papers), Trauma and Emergency Care Studies (20 papers) and Muscle and Compartmental Disorders (17 papers). Saeed Safari is often cited by papers focused on Emergency and Acute Care Studies (20 papers), Trauma and Emergency Care Studies (20 papers) and Muscle and Compartmental Disorders (17 papers). Saeed Safari collaborates with scholars based in Iran, Egypt and Iraq. Saeed Safari's co-authors include Alireza Baratloo, Mahmoud Yousefifard, Ahmed Negida, Mostafa Hosseini, Mohamed Elfil, Masoud Baikpour, Parisa Ghelichkhani, Mohammad Mehdi Forouzanfar, Hadi Asady and Hamidreza Hatamabadi and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of The Electrochemical Society and Scientific Reports.
